Transaction 2d82c3402d470bb3823827cf6f1712188715b486d7c500476d5d236363a9bebd
1 Input
1 Output
-
2d82c3402d470bb3823827cf6f1712188715b486d7c500476d5d236363a9bebd:0
- value
- 649736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8680b10d9f98e3d6f83a37435e1bc5ba7141c7dc OP_EQUAL
- address
- 3DxCdu6x85ZYdoJXymtLPhPARro4t5EuLZ